How they compare
Ghana currently reports 94.6% against 94.4% in Russian Federation, a difference of 0.2%.
Across all 10 years both countries report, Russian Federation has been ahead every year.
Ghana ranks 92nd and Russian Federation ranks 94th of 180 countries.
Russian Federation has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ghana | Russian Federation |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 80.0% | 94.2% | 14.2% | Russian Federation |
| 2010s | 90.7% | 97.0% | 6.3% | Russian Federation |
| 2020s | 85.8% | 97.9% | 12.1% | Russian Federation |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
